Comprehending Conservatories
Before diving into renovation, it is vital to comprehend what a conservatory is. A conservatory is generally defined as a structure with glass walls and a glass roof, created to cultivate and display plants, while also working as a recreational area. They can vary significantly in regards to design, size, and function, ranging from small sun parlors to extensive garden spaces.

The ideal time for renovation is generally during the spring or early summer when the weather is mild, and professionals are more easily offered.
The length of time does a conservatory renovation typically take?
The duration of renovation can vary from a couple of weeks to numerous months, depending on the level of the work needed and the products selected.
Exist any permits needed for conservatory renovation?
Laws differ by place. It's advisable to talk to regional authorities or a contractor acquainted with regional building regulations.
Can I pursue a DIY conservatory renovation?
While some elements (like painting and decor) may be workable on a DIY basis, structural work or specialized installations ought to preferably be managed by professionals.
What features can I include to a conservatory for better performance?
Consider integrating features such as automatic blinds, ceiling fans, heater, and even a small kitchenette to improve use.
